The Department of Geographical Sciences has developed a series of high school programs to ignite students' passion for geographical sciences and cultivate a deeper understanding of important issues for Earth and humanity.
Through engaging and interactive activities, our programs offer high school students the opportunity to explore the multifaceted aspects of geographical sciences.
Your gift to the High School Hub will allow us to:
- Outreach to public schools to recognize high school students who stand out in geographical sciences.
- Bring high school students for a day of activities at the Department of Geographical Sciences.
- Provide paid internships to highly motivated students focusing on university-level, geographical science research.
The High School Hub has grown directly in response to the enthusiasm and need of our initial cohorts of high school students. On their behalf, we express our heartfelt gratitude for your support!
